如何优化 测距时绘线慢的问题

0 投票
1、在TrackingLayer中实现自定义测距、测面的功能,

2、测距时 绘制线 是用的mapControl.getMap().getTrackingLayer().add(geoline,"a");

然后长度获取的是geoline.getLength()                  

  现在碰到的问题就是 线条绘制 的太慢了,经常长度都已经出来了,线条还在绘制     有没有可以优化的、或者是采用的别的方法
8月 1, 2017 分类:  223次浏览 | 用户: pony 初出茅庐 (38 分)

1个回答

0 投票
绘制线是用的超图的action,还是自己写的Android的触摸点击事件,然后由点构造线后,将线添加到图层里的,如果是action的话,觉得慢,需要检查下是否绘制完了有更新地图,而地图要素比较多,导致渲染慢,如果是自己写的手势事件,那么这个性能慢就得优化手势事件。
8月 1, 2017 用户: 杨兵 学富五车 (640 分)
...